This thesis examines Anne Brontë’s "The Tenant of Wildfell Hall" and its relation to Charlotte Brontë’s "Jane Eyre." The main objective of this thesis is presenting "The Tenant of Wildfell Hall" as a text written in reaction to "Jane Eyre" and as its critique.
